With the DAC connected for 0 to 10V output (Figure 13),
the adjustment procedure is to set the DAC code and mea-
sure as follows:
FOURTH MSB ADJUSTMENT (Pin 36)
1. Set Code = 11 1100 0000 0000 0000
2. Measure V
3. Set Code = 11 1011 1111 1111 1111
4. Measure V
5. Adjust 4th MSB potentiometer to make difference +38 V.
6. Repeat steps 1 through 5 to confirm.
THIRD MSB ADJUSTMENT (Pin 37)
1. Set Code = 11 1000 0000 0000 0000
2. Measure V
3. Set Code = 11 0111 1111 1111 1111
4. Measure V
5. Adjust 3rd MSB potentiometer to make difference +38 V.
6. Repeat steps 1 through 5 to confirm.
